CORONERS ACT 2008 (NO. 77 OF 2008) - SECT 78

Appeal in relation to determination that death not a reportable death

    (1)     If a coroner determines that a death is not a reportable death, the person who reported the death may appeal against the coroner's determination to the Trial Division of the Supreme Court constituted by a single judge.

    (2)     Subject to section 86, an appeal under this section must be made within 3 months after the day on which the determination of the coroner is made.
